Day-by-Day Itinerary


Arrive in Casablanca and begin your Moroccan adventure with a visit to the impressive Hassan II Mosque, standing proudly on the Atlantic coast. If time allows, explore Mohammed V Square, take a memorable photo at Ricks Cafe, or enjoy a relaxing walk along the Corniche. This is the perfect start to experiencing the beauty and culture of Morocco.

Travel north to Rabat, Morocco’s capital city, to see the Hassan Tower, the Mausoleum of Mohammed V, and the peaceful Kasbah of the Udayas. In the afternoon, head into the Rif Mountains and arrive in Chefchaouen, the famous Blue City. Spend the evening strolling through its charming blue-painted streets and soaking in the relaxed atmosphere.

Start your day exploring Chefchaouen’s picturesque alleys. Continue to the Roman ruins of Volubilis, known for stunning mosaics and ancient history. Then visit Meknes to see the grand Bab al Mansour gate, the royal granaries, and the mausoleum of Sultan Moulay Ismail. End your day in the cultural city of Fes, ready for the next day’s discoveries.

Spend the day with a local guide exploring the historic medina of Fes. See the grand Royal Palace gate, walk through the old Jewish Quarter, and enjoy a panoramic city view. Wander the narrow streets filled with artisan workshops, visit the ancient University of Al Quaraouiyine, and explore the colorful tanneries.

Journey through Ifrane, known as Moroccos Switzerland, and stop at a cedar forest where playful Barbary macaques live. After lunch in Midelt, travel through the lush Ziz Valley before reaching Merzouga on the edge of the Sahara. Ride a camel across the golden dunes at sunset and spend the night in a comfortable and luxury desert camp under a star filled sky.

Wake early to watch a breathtaking sunrise over the dunes. Spend the day exploring the beauty of the desert, walk through palm groves, visit local nomad camps, enjoy traditional Gnawa music in Khamlia village, or discover a hidden desert lake. Relax in the peaceful silence of the Sahara before another magical night.

Start with a visit to Rissanis traditional market, then stop in Erfoud to learn about fossil crafts. Travel through scenic palm groves to the impressive Todra Gorge where high red cliffs tower above you. Continue to the Dades Valley for an overnight stay surrounded by dramatic rock formations and quiet landscapes.

Begin with the fragrant Rose Valley in Kalaat Mgouna known for its rose products. Pass through the green Skoura Oasis to explore the historic Amridil Kasbah. Visit Ait Ben Haddou a UNESCO World Heritage site and famous film location before crossing the High Atlas Mountains via the Tizi n Tichka pass to reach Marrakech in the evening.

Explore Marrakech with a local guide. Visit the beautiful Bahia Palace and the peaceful Ben Youssef Madrasa. Walk through the colorful souks, feel the lively atmosphere of Jemaa el Fna square, and end your tour relaxing in the calm Majorelle Garden.

Enjoy a scenic drive to Essaouira, a charming coastal town. Pass through argan tree farms where goats sometimes climb the branches. Explore the old fishing port, stroll along the historic ramparts, and enjoy the fresh sea air before returning to Marrakech in the evening.
